环境:
  • Python3.6.5
  • Windows
  • pycharm
模块:
  • import requests
  • import jsonpath from urllib.request
  • import urlretrieve import os
思路:
进入LOL官网的游戏资料-资料库后,可以看到所有的英雄都在里面。
当我们点击英雄头像时,会跳转到皮肤界面。
一般人的做法就是,采集到跳转的url,然后再请求该url获取皮肤数据。
思路没错,但是要想一下,如果源代码中没有跳转的url呢?
elements中确实有该链接,但是源代码中没有:
这个时候,毫无疑问 --抓包吧:
很多人做到这里无从下手了,并没有跳转的url,但是你没发现跳转的url只有一个地方放生了变化吗?(自行观察)
就只有后面的数字发生了变化,而我们的banaudio这个标签当中的url末尾是不是也有个1.ogg???
获取到数字1即可自行构造跳转的url。
到了跳转页面后,会发现网页源代码中同样不存在我们想要的图片数据(继续抓包):
OK,问题已经得到解决,很简单的一个案例。
效果

打造最全皮肤,Python采集英雄联盟(LOL)官...相关推荐

  1. 打造最全皮肤,Python采集英雄联盟(LOL)官网数据!

    环境: Python3.6.5 Windows pycharm 模块: import requests import jsonpath from urllib.request import urlre ...

  2. python下载英雄联盟皮肤

    这里写自定义目录标题 python--下载英雄联盟皮肤图片 程序源代码 python–下载英雄联盟皮肤图片 一个简单的代码,就可以把英雄联盟英雄全部的皮肤爬取下载以及保存到mongodb数据库中 因为 ...

  3. python 预测足球_利用 Python 预测英雄联盟胜负,分析了 5 万多场比赛才得出的数据!...

    今天教大家用Python预测英雄联盟比赛胜负. Show me data,用数据说话 今天我们聊一聊 Python预测LOL胜负 目前,英雄联盟S10全球总决赛正在火热进行中,最终决赛于10月31日在 ...

  4. python 比赛成绩预测_利用 Python 预测英雄联盟胜负,分析了 5 万多场比赛才得出的数据!值得,涨知识了!...

    Mika 来源 | 头图 |CSDN自东方IC今天教大家用Python预测英雄联盟比赛胜负. Show me data,用数据说话 今天我们聊一聊 Python预测LOL胜负 目前,英雄联盟S10全球 ...

  5. 利用 Python 预测英雄联盟胜负,分析了 5 万多场比赛才得出的数据!

    作者 | 真达.Mika 来源 | CDA数据分析师(ID:cdacdacda) 头图 |  CSDN 下载自东方IC 今天教大家用Python预测英雄联盟比赛胜负. Show me data,用数据 ...

  6. lol大洋洲服务器账号,英雄联盟大洋洲官网

    英雄联盟大洋洲官网是一款可以和自己的好友一起在场中展开5V5塔防战斗的竞技类游戏,这里的模式有很多种,而且在操作的时候也会要比较好的技术,里面的人物每一个都有着自己的特殊技能,而且他们还有着各种炫酷的 ...

  7. Python获取英雄联盟的皮肤原画:新手玩家们都懵了!(一)

    本爬虫是为了经验交流,如果读者需要转载,请注明出处和链接 希望:喜欢博主的读者,可以点个关注~,更多精彩内容请收藏本栏目,不定期添加干货. 代码:如果你订阅了本专栏可以直接私信我,我可以发给你完整的代 ...

  8. 用Python获取英雄联盟所有皮肤图片

    先来看一张图片. image.png 先讲解下思路,然后直接放源码,想要获取源码的同学直接拉到最下面就好. 1.爬虫第一步 首先要分析网页的DOM结构,就是英雄联盟官网,然后在下面找到英雄资料.然后在 ...

  9. Python获取英雄联盟皮肤原画:新手玩家们都懵了!

    前言 夜太美,爬虫就没那么危险 善于利用他人的UA 爬虫过程分析网页获取每一位英雄的ID值分析原画网页 结语 前言 学习py也有不少时间了,老是忘记写博客,我自己也是很无奈呀!作为会为代码而疯狂的啃书 ...

最新文章

  1. KM(知识管理)与SharePoint Portal
  2. 大数据时代,如何让个人信息不再“裸奔”?
  3. 房贷是不是越多越久越好?
  4. 2021手机CIS技术趋势总结
  5. Java EE并发API教程
  6. 阿里云迁云方式大汇总 1
  7. java中equals理解(2)
  8. AI项目商务合作,寻广州附近计算机视觉算法团队!
  9. ParaView绘制gprMax正演模拟的波场快照方法(1)
  10. android wchar t 中文,Android没有真正的wchar_t吗?
  11. 理解BERT每一层都学到了什么
  12. 阿里巴巴Java性能调优实战(2021华山版)
  13. MCGS 昆仑通态触摸屏 modbus TCP 数据转发
  14. 挑战性价比,刷新你对千元级投影仪的认知,这份详细评测送给你
  15. [注]打动我的50句广告语
  16. 手动查毒删除病毒文件图
  17. 天龙八部手游服务器维护公告,-天龙八部手游-详情页-官方网站-天龙八部官方唯一正版3DMMORPG武侠手游...
  18. 经典文章:一位营销总监的辞职信及回复
  19. Python-小游戏-乌龟吃鱼
  20. 人工智能会话代理在医疗保健中的有效性:系统综述

热门文章

  1. MATLAB:plot3函数详解
  2. 批处理学习教程(3)------if的用法
  3. 批处理文件中的延时、变量、for、if等语句
  4. 鱼眼图像矫正之——柱面模型投影公式推导
  5. 适合苹果4s的微信版本_苹果最后通牒催这些设备升级系统,说好不升级再战十年?...
  6. 百度爬虫:百度蜘蛛都有哪些抓取规律和习惯
  7. html地图定位系统原理代码,利用HTML5定位功能实现在百度地图上定位
  8. 剑指offer系列——剑指 Offer II 036. 后缀表达式(逆波兰表达式)
  9. Python turtle库改变海龟速度的几种方法
  10. 腾达宽带连接服务器无响应,腾达(Tenda)无线路由器192.168.0.1打不开问题解决方法图文教程...